Cocoamine Application scenarios
1. Surfactant Raw Materials and Daily Chemical Additives:
As an intermediate in the synthesis of cationic/amphoteric surfactants (such as cocamidopropyl betaine), used in fabric softeners, antistatic agents, hair conditioners, and shampoos; it can also be used directly or derived as an active ingredient in detergents and disinfectants.
2. Mineral Flotation (Cationic Collector):
In the beneficiation of non-ferrous metals such as copper, lead, and zinc, and non-metallic minerals (such as feldspar and quartz), it selectively adsorbs onto the mineral surface, causing it to float hydrophobically, achieving separation of minerals from gangue, and improving recovery rate and grade.
3. Asphalt Emulsifier:
Derived into quaternary ammonium salts, etc., it is used as a road asphalt emulsifier to prepare cationic asphalt emulsions, facilitating cold mixing and slurry sealing, and improving workability and adhesion.
4. Pesticide/Agrochemical Auxiliaries:
Used as emulsifiers, dispersants, wetting agents, and spreading agents in emulsifiable concentrates and suspensions to improve pesticide stability, wetting, spreading, and penetration, thereby enhancing efficacy.
5. Textile Printing and Dyeing Auxiliaries:
Used as softeners, antistatic agents, and dyeing auxiliaries in fabric finishing to improve hand feel, reduce static electricity, and improve dyeing uniformity; also used in fiber oil formulations.
6. Water Treatment and Corrosion/Rust Prevention:
Used as corrosion inhibitors and bactericides/algaecides in industrial circulating water and cooling water treatment; also used as rust/corrosion inhibitors in metalworking fluids and lubricants, forming a protective film on metal surfaces to inhibit oxidation and corrosion.
7. Coating/Ink/Pigment Auxiliaries:
Used as dispersants, wetting agents, and anti-settling agents to improve pigment dispersion stability, leveling, and hiding power; also possesses certain anti-corrosion properties, improving coating water resistance and adhesion.
8. Resin and Polymer Modification:
It participates in the synthesis or crosslinking of epoxy resins, phenolic resins, etc., to improve adhesion, water resistance, and mechanical properties; it is also used as an antistatic agent and mold release agent in plastic processing.
